Benefits of Minimalism

There are many benefits to using a minimalist and clean WordPress theme. Wondering what these benefits are? We’ve listed them down below.

Gives A Professional Look

Stun your visitors with a professional website by sticking with a minimalist design. Minimalist WordPress themes help you keep your site beautiful and elegant without appearing too bloated. A simple design is universally loved in general as they tend to give a classy vibe.

Ironically, the fewer elements a page has, the more professional it can look. You are showing your visitors that your brand and content are what really matter and that you don’t need fancy elements to provide value.

Highlights Content

It’s easier to highlight your content because a clean WordPress theme is not overloaded with animations, colors, and other elements.

Ever wondered why minimalist WordPress themes are in demand among creative professionals?

It’s all because a simple yet sleek web design won’t overshadow the beauty of their works. Thanks to a minimalist web design, their beautiful works get to stand out even more!

Focuses on What Matters

With a minimalist design, the visitor’s focus doesn’t stray towards unnecessary elements. Instead, it leads your visitors to focus on the things that matter the most, such as those call-to-action buttons that you want your visitors to click.

Faster loading times

The fewer resources a page requires, the faster it will load. When using a minimalist theme chances are that we’ll be using far fewer components on our page. This will generally result in faster loading times that will for sure impact the SEO ranking of your page too.

4. Astra

Astra Minimalist Theme for WordPress

Price: starts at $47

Astra made it to the list of the best minimalist WordPress themes because it’s highly customizable and super lightweight. It has a posh yet minimalist vibe that makes it perfect for creatives looking for a simple theme for their portfolio.

Astra got rid of jQuery completely and pays special attention to loading times. It’s completely Open Sourced and available on the Astra repository at GitHub. Oh, and it’s fully compatible with all major WordPress builders too.

If you are one of those who likes starting with a template, with the additional plugin “Astra Starter Sites” you’ll be able to use more than 70 templates on Astra.
